I wish to implement the DataFrame library for Boost. I have made the
project proposal and am attaching the same.
As, this project is an expansion of the previous project
<https://github.com/BoostGSoC19/data_frame> there are a few directions that
I would like to work in whichever adds more to the project.

1. We could be to keep the existing code base as it is and implement new
features on top of it.
2. We could try to restructure the code into *Modules*(C++20 feature) and
then implement the features.
3. Or, we could restructure the code without ET but rather using *C++20 One
Ranges*. This makes more sense to me as I believe that uBlas is being
ported to C++20.

The DataFrame would include the following features:
1. All the features already present(union, combine, join).
2. Read/write from *DataFrame using JSON*(boost::property_tree to DataFrame)
3. Operator support for addition, subtraction, multiplication, division,
modulo and power, etc as well as support for comparison operators.
4. Functions to perform apply, apply_element_wise, aggregate, transform and
expand on a given DataFrame.
5. Data analysis tools for standard deviation, variance, mean, etc.
6. Re-indexing methods like replace, duplicate, filter, etc.
7. Reshaping methods for sorting, append, pivot, etc.
